Company info

  • SpringWorks Therapeutics, a healthcare company of Merck KGaA, Darmstadt, Germany, is a commercial-stage biopharmaceutical company dedicated to improving the lives of patients with rare tumors.
  • We developed and are commercializing the first and only FDA and EC approved medicine for adults with desmoid tumors and the first and only FDA and EC approved medicine for both adults and children with neurofibromatosis type 1 associated plexiform neurofibromas (NF1-PN).
